Transaction 143bb62bef91da566b7ef244350688ec5764e784835f2bfd76b44f6a3b7ed59d
1 Input
1 Output
-
143bb62bef91da566b7ef244350688ec5764e784835f2bfd76b44f6a3b7ed59d:0
- value
- 792025
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 045ee99c523c377fa9d6a12ab8c97226703f4045 OP_EQUAL
- address
- 3268Kx4JAAXfkqaAPAusKmnrcxcHWu4i4w